About the Artist
Rototom Sunsplash is renowned for its incredible line-ups, consistently bringing together legendary pioneers and the freshest new talent in reggae and its associated genres. While the full artist roster for 2026 is yet to be unveiled, you can expect a smorgasbord of musical talent. Past editions have featured icons like Burning Spear, Steel Pulse, Jimmy Cliff, and Damian "Jr. Gong" Marley, alongside contemporary stars such as Chronixx, Protoje, and Koffee. Rototom prides itself on showcasing the diverse spectrum of Jamaican music and its global influences. Expect electrifying performances that will have you dancing from dusk till dawn, with a focus on authentic roots reggae, soul-stirring dub, infectious dancehall, and upbeat ska. The festival is a platform for artists who not only deliver phenomenal music but also champion messages of peace, social justice, and environmental awareness. The Venue
Rototom Sunsplash takes place in Benicàssim, a picturesque coastal town in the province of Castellón, on Spain's Costa del Azahar. The festival grounds are strategically located close to the beach, offering festival-goers the perfect blend of music and seaside relaxation. The main stages are set up to accommodate massive crowds, with state-of-the-art sound and lighting systems ensuring an incredible viewing and listening experience. Beyond the main stages, the festival boasts multiple smaller areas, each with its own unique vibe and musical focus. You'll find intimate dub tents, acoustic stages, and chill-out zones perfect for taking a breather. The venue is designed to be a self-contained world, with food stalls offering a global culinary journey, craft markets brimming with unique finds, and spaces dedicated to art installations and workshops. The proximity to the Mediterranean Sea means you can easily slip away for a refreshing dip between sets or enjoy the sea breeze as you soak in the festival atmosphere. Practical Information
Dates: The Rototom Music Festival 2026 runs for six days, commencing on Monday, August 17th, 2026.
Location: Rototom Sunsplash, Benicàssim, Castellón, Spain.
Weather: August in Benicàssim is typically hot and sunny, with average temperatures ranging from the mid-20s to low-30s Celsius. Pack light clothing, swimwear, sunscreen, a hat, and sunglasses. Evenings can be pleasant, but a light jacket or jumper might be useful.
Accommodation: While camping options are often available directly at the festival site (check for details and booking), many attendees opt for nearby hotels, apartments, or hostels in Benicàssim and surrounding towns like Castellón. Booking accommodation well in advance is highly recommended due to the festival's popularity.
Getting Around: The festival site is extensive but navigable. Comfortable footwear is a must. Shuttle buses often operate between the festival grounds, accommodation areas, and local transport hubs. Public transport options to Benicàssim include trains and buses from major Spanish cities. The nearest major airport is Valencia (VLC), approximately 1 hour away by train or car.
What to Bring: Essentials include your festival ticket, ID, comfortable clothing and footwear, swimwear, sunscreen, hat, sunglasses, reusable water bottle, portable charger, and any personal medication. Cash is useful for smaller vendors, though many accept cards.
Currency: The currency is the Euro (€).
Language: Spanish and Valencian are the official languages. English is widely spoken in tourist areas and at the festival.
Health & Safety: Medical facilities are available on-site. Stay hydrated, especially during the daytime heat. Be aware of your surroundings and keep valuables secure.
